Buckets of charm.. but couldn’t get life together
Mum’s agony for Gogglebox fave George
THE heartbroken mother of Gogglebox star George Gilbey says he had only been back at work for three days and was trying to “rebuild his life” when he died.
Linda McGarry, 74, paid tribute to her son as a devoted father who had “buckets of personality”.
George, 40, died last Wednesday after falling from height while working at a warehouse in Shoebury, Essex.
He became famous on Channel 4 show Gogglebox alongside Linda and his stepdad Pete, who died in 2021, aged 71, from bowel cancer.
Linda said of her son’s death: “I’m devastated, he was like my best friend. He had the best heart in the world. He was generous, funny and kind, with bundles of charm and personality.
“He did more in his 40 years than people do in 90 – he even had dinner with the Prince of Dubai. He was crazy, but after coming out of showbiz, he could not get his life back together. He couldn’t get over the death of Pete.”
ALCOHOL
George, who had a seven-year-old daughter Amelie by former partner Gemma Conway, had problems with alcohol. In 2018, he was convicted of attacking Gemma in a drunken rage.
A year later, he was jailed for three months for drink-driving.
The relationship with Gemma broke down, but Linda said: “He was a stay-at-home dad after Amelie was born. He was such a good dad. Amelie was his absolute world. He lived for that little girl and his mum. “George was a real contradiction, he was so funny and so intelligent.
“He was smart, quickwitted and he was loud and outgoing, but at the same time very sensitive. He helped others, but struggled himself.
“I have been diagnosed with Parkinson’s disease and George took it worse than me. He was a mummy’s boy.”
George joined Gogglebox in 2013 after a friend said they were auditioning for a new TV show. Linda said: “He did an interview, but his friends were too shy. So they called me in. My husband was shy, but he did it anyway. It just took off from there.”
The family were ditched after George signed up for Celebrity Big Brother in 2014, reaching the final. In 2016, they returned, but George left again in 2018 and Linda and Pete continued without him until 2020.
Linda, of Clacton-on-Sea, Essex, said: “He came to celebrity overnight but didn’t really want it – he was just normal.”
Police and the Health and Safety Executive are probing his death. A man in his 40s was arrested on suspicion of gross negligence manslaughter.
